Sebi plans tweaks to address derivative trading risks: Report

Image
[hfe_template id='11223'] [ad_1] Sebi is considering a series of tweaks to its derivative trading rules, according to two sources, as it seeks to address risks arising from explosive growth in options trading. The new rules could include higher margins for options contracts and more detailed disclosures, and are being considered after a series of meetings with exchanges, brokers, and fund houses over the past four months, the sources, with direct knowledge of the matter, said. Both sources declined to be identified as they are not authorised to speak to the media. Trading in index and stock options has soared in India in the last few years, fueled mainly by retail investors, sparking warnings from market participants and government officials. The notional value of index options traded more than doubled in 2023-24 to $907.09 trillion from the year before. Ex-Jane Street trader pillories claims he stole trade secrets

[hfe_template id='11223'] [ad_1] A former Jane Street Group trader who moved to Millennium Management ridiculed his former employer’s claims that he used its secret strategy to make a killing at his new job in India’s options market. Responding to a lawsuit filed by Jane Street this month, Douglas Schadewald said it was “not only wrong, but impossible” that he and a fellow defector, Daniel Spottiswood, cost the company more than $150 million in profits between February and March when they went to work for rival Millennium. Labeling Jane Street’s claim as “reckless speculation,” Schadewald said the amount the duo brought in for Millennium through mid-April was about $4 million. In its complaint, Jane Street accused the two of using its “immensely valuable” proprietary strategy in their new jobs.
